Alber Blanc is an engineering start-up focused on developing industrial-grade robotic platforms for video monitoring and secure performance monitoring in various industries. Their product provides a full automatization of data collection, analysis, and visualization without human involvement. For achieving their goals company is using tech-edge technologies of autonomous navigation and computer vision, intelligent control systems for electronic components including self-diagnosis systems and energy-saving modes.
ABOUT THE POSITION:
This is a senior engineering position responsible for supporting and developing a framework that enables the ecosystem of our hardware components.
THE QUALIFICATIONS WE ARE LOOKING FOR:
- Proficiency in programming languages like C++ and C;
- Solid knowledge of CMake;
- Familiarity with the STM32 family of microcontrollers;
- Practical experience in programming bare metal;
- Practical experience with RTOS;
- Practical experience in using Gtest;
- Experience debugging software with the use of UARTs, JTAG, and oscilloscopes;
- Experience in system architecture and software development organization;
- Ability to work under minimal direction.
NICE TO HAVE:
- Experience in control systems topics such as Kalman filter and PIDs;
- Proficiency in programming languages like Go, and Javascript.
WHAT WE OFFER:
- Ability to make an impact on business;
- Some great perks of being a part of a startup team;
- Relocation package, if you’re based out of UAE;
- Flexible working hours;
- Competitive salary;
- Great office in Dubai Silicon Oasis;
- Medical insurance.